The conversational interface is the future of software.Users no longer want to switch between apps—they want to stay in the conversation and let AI handle the rest. With the Model Context Protocol and OpenAI’s Apps SDK, developers can build applications that live directly inside ChatGPT.This practical, hands-on guide takes you from concept to published app. Using a real-world profile discovery feature as the running project, you’ll build a complete ChatGPT application—including an MCP server, React widgets, OAuth authentication, and everything required for App Store submission.What You’ll Learn:Part I: Foundations — Understand the shift from traditional UIs to conversational interfaces and how ChatGPT’s architecture enables app-like experiences.Part II: The MCP Server — Build a production-ready MCP server with TypeScript. Implement tools with proper annotations, define JSON schemas, and connect to real data sources.Part III: ChatGPT Widgets — Create React components that render inside ChatGPT. Master the window.openai SDK, manage state across conversation turns, and design responsive widget layouts.Part IV: End-to-End Integration — Connect servers and widgets using OAuth 2.1, deploy to production, and ensure reliable, secure data flow.Part V: App Approval & Best Practices — Learn what separates approved apps from rejected ones: UX decision matrices, tool naming conventions, state management patterns, privacy requirements, a 15-prompt testing library, and a widget debugging playbook.This Book Includes:• Complete TypeScript and React code examples• Reference tables and architecture diagrams• Anti-pattern warnings to avoid common mistakes• A pre-submission checklist for App Store approvalWho This Book Is For:Developers who want to build real, production-ready ChatGPT apps. This book assumes basic familiarity with web development and is focused on practical implementation—not theory. Read more
